scarf


I have been wanting to make one of these scarfs for awhile now and since I have plans to go north this coming Friday it is now time that I will need one. I started with 1/3 yard of black fleece. {I had looked at more interesting colors/patterns, but my jacket is white, with some red and black...decided black was my best choice. Discovered that there are so many shades of red.} I cut it in half and laid the 2 pieces on top of each other and sewed down the middle. This was nerve wracking for me to make sure that it stayed straight but it was actually quite simple.













Now onto a half inch from the middle on the right.













1/2 inch from the middle on the left.









I then laid it out and cut every 2 inches on each side.






Here it is all completed sporting it with my coat.
